Trust and Safety
PU Prime operates under several regulatory frameworks and holds licences from ASIC, FSA (SC), FSCA, and FSC. Its UAE entity, PU Prime Financial Services (PUPFS), is licensed by the Capital Market Authority to conduct introducing and promotional activities. It acts strictly as an introducing broker and does not hold client accounts, manage client funds, or execute trades.
Client funds are kept separate from the broker’s operating funds and held with AA-rated banks. This segregation is designed to reduce the risk associated with the company’s day-to-day operations.
PU Prime also has a dedicated risk management team that monitors trading activity for unusual or potentially suspicious behaviour. In addition, its brand-monitoring team works to identify unauthorised websites and online services using the PU Prime name.
The broker is a member of the Financial Commission, which provides an independent dispute-resolution process and compensation of up to €20,000 per eligible complaint. Eligible clients can also receive automatic insurance coverage of up to $1 million through PU Prime’s partnership with Lloyd’s Insurance.
Negative balance protection provides another layer of risk management by preventing eligible clients from losing more than the funds available in their trading account.

Account Types
PU Prime offers several account structures designed to accommodate different levels of experience and trading approaches.
Standard Account
The Standard account follows a spread-only pricing model. This keeps the cost structure relatively simple, making it suitable for newer traders and those who prefer not to pay a separate trading commission.
Prime Account
The Prime account is designed for more active traders. It provides tighter spreads while applying a fixed commission per lot. This structure can be more attractive to traders who place larger or more frequent orders.
ECN Account
The ECN account offers spreads that can start close to zero, combined with commission-based pricing. It is aimed primarily at high-volume, professional, and algorithmic traders. The account requires a higher minimum deposit than the Standard and other entry-level options.
Cent Account
The Cent account allows traders to work with balances denominated in cents. With a minimum deposit of $20, it provides a way to trade live markets with smaller position sizes and lower overall exposure.
Demo Account
PU Prime provides demo accounts that replicate live trading conditions and can be customised for testing strategies. Demo accounts are available for both MT4 and MT5.
Islamic Account
Swap-free Islamic accounts are available for eligible traders across the account range. Instead of conventional swap charges, alternative administrative fees may apply when positions remain open beyond the permitted period.

Unique Features
PU Copy Trading
One of PU Prime’s notable features is its proprietary PU Copy Trading service.
The platform provides three allocation methods: Equivalent Used Margin, Fixed Lots, and Fixed Multiples. These options allow users to determine how copied trades should be allocated rather than simply mirroring another trader’s positions at a fixed ratio.

Deposits and Withdrawals
PU Prime supports a broad selection of deposit and withdrawal methods for its international client base.
Deposits
Clients can fund their accounts using credit and debit cards, e-wallets, local and international bank transfers, and selected cryptocurrencies, including USDT and Bitcoin.
PU Prime does not charge deposit fees, although processing times depend on the payment method selected.
Withdrawals
Withdrawals are processed using supported funding methods and are subject to applicable AML and CTF requirements.
Processing times vary by payment method. E-wallet and digital-wallet withdrawals can be processed on the same day, while card and bank-transfer withdrawals may take between one and five business days. Cryptocurrency withdrawals depend on blockchain network confirmations.
